Now you can choose a new car, if you want to, by PM to me. Car change is optional - you can stay with the car you have now if you want.
The upcoming tracks are: Mugello, Spa, Pukekohe.
In addition, I am changing the BMW M3 E30 Group A (too slow) to the BMW M3 E30 DTM (a bit slower than the Alfa and Merc, but faster than the Ferrari 458).
So the cars to choose from are:
- Ferrari 458 Italia
- Ferrari F40
- KTM X-Bow R
- BMW M3 E30 DTM
- Mercedes-Benz 190E EVO II (DLC content)
- Alfa Romeo 155 V6 (DLC content)

Give the m3 DTM a good test before choosing, I think the grp A drives much better but the dtm is clearly a few seconds a lap quicker. It really has become much more of a handful since v1.1 though and is only just around the merc for pace but quite a bit trickier to get that pace out of it.
I wonder how many Alfa guys are going to switch to a ferrari considering Mugello and Spa have some rather good sections to unleash the italian horses. I think the DTM's will still have a significant advantage laptime wise but in the race it may be very hard for the DTM's to pass a ferrari or even defend against them in the high speed sections. ;)
